Program goal

The K-12 reading specialist concentration in the Master of Education in Reading program is designed to provide experienced teachers who are prospective reading specialists with a program of sequential and integrated experiences in areas of the reading curriculum ranging from preschool to adult levels. Students will gain an understanding of the developmental and diagnostic processes involved in teaching reading and the language arts and will become familiar with the resource and supervisory functions that are part of the specialist role. Prior to graduation, students must complete a reading portfolio documenting their work in the program and related work experiences and pass state-mandated licensure/endorsement assessments.

The M.Ed. in Reading is an approved program (K-12) for students who meet Virginia State Department of Education requirements. The reading specialist endorsement also requires completion of three years of teaching in a reading-related field.

This program is available in an online format.

Reading core outcomes

  1. Demonstrate content knowledge to support literacy and language learning
  2. Effectively plan instruction or fulfill other professional responsibilities that attend to learner differences
  3. Effectively apply knowledge, skills and dispositions in practice

K-12 reading specialist concentration-specific outcomes

  1. Develop skills integral to the literacy professional role to support teacher professional development
